The underlying principle behind the principle of stair decisis is _
myrzilka [38]

Answer:

Binding precedent relies on the legal principle of stare decisis.

Explanation:

Stare decisis is a legal doctrine that obligates courts to follow historical cases when making a ruling on a similar case.

Stare decisis means to stand by things decided. It ensures certainty and consistency in the application of law.
